Troubleshooting for Your Workshop Remote Control
It’s not always a defect when the remote control doesn’t work. Often, there are simple causes that can be quickly resolved. First, check the batteries. Weak batteries are the most common cause of malfunctions. Another frequent error is incorrect programming. In this case, a look at the operating manual will help. If the remote control still does not work, a reset may help. To do this, press the reset button or remove the batteries for a few minutes.
